MI Cape Town (MICT) will be crossing paths with Paarl Royals (PR) in match number six of the SA20 2025 season on Monday, January 13. Both teams started off with a win over defending champions Sunrisers Eastern Cape. The upcoming match marks the first home fixture of the season for the MI Cape Town.

MICT vs PR: Match 6 Preview
MI Cape Town
MI Cape Town walloped Sunrises Eastern Cape by 97 runs in the opening match of the SA20 2025 season. Rashid Khan’s troops failed to sustain their winning momentum as they lost to Joburg Super Kings a couple of days later in Johannesburg. With a win and a defeat from two matches, the NRR of the MI Cape Town stands at a formidable 2.889. Dewald Brevis and George Linde seem to be in good nick with the bat for the MI franchise, while all-rounder Delano Potgieter has managed to excel with both bat and ball off late. Moreover, Potgieter is also leading the wicket-taking charts of the SA20 2025 season with five scalps from two innings.
Paarl Royals
Paarl Royals opened up their SA20 2025 campaign with an emphatic nine-wicket win over Sunrisers Eastern Cape in the third match of the season. Their current NRR of 0.679 stands among the best of all teams, as they aim to carry on with their winning ways. For the Royals, young Lhuan-dre Pretorius punched out a match-winning 51-ball 97 at a blistering strike rate of 190.19 against the Sunrisers bowlers. Senior man Joe Root also plundered an artistic 62* after Mujeeb Ur Rahman and Kwena Maphaka restricted Aiden Markram and co. with two wickets apiece.

Pitch Report
The conditions at the Newlands Cricket Ground tends to offer a hint of seam movement for the fast bowlers, especially with the new ball. However, batters can find it comparatively easier to bat after surviving the initial burst. The average first innings total at the venue in all SA20 matches hosted so far has amounted to 157. The captain winning the toss will likely opt to field first, as the chasing sides have a favorable track record here in SA20 games.
